快速下载

下载 Postman

Postman使用教程:深度解析环境搭建与多端数据同步技巧

教程指南
Postman使用教程:深度解析环境搭建与多端数据同步技巧

针对开发者在API开发初期的痛点,本篇Postman使用教程将跳过冗长的工具定义,直击安装配置与实战应用。我们将详细拆解Postman v10及以上版本的核心差异,指导新手如何快速完成从本地Scratchpad到云端Workspace的无缝迁移。无论你是面临SSL证书报错的调试困境,还是需要跨团队同步接口参数,本文提供的实战方案都能帮助你建立标准化的接口测试流,显著提升联调效率并确保数据资产安全。

在API优先的开发时代,掌握Postman不仅是学会发请求,更是要建立一套可复用的测试工作流。本教程将带你避开新手常见的配置坑位,实现从零到进阶的跨越。

环境部署:版本选择与初始化配置要点

开始Postman使用教程的第一步是明确运行环境。建议直接从官网下载适用于Windows或macOS的桌面客户端,而非仅依赖Web端,因为桌面版在处理本地网络请求和文件上传时具有更高权限。在Postman v10版本中,系统默认强化了云端协作功能。安装完成后,新手最常忽略的是“Settings”中的基础配置。建议立即进入“General”选项卡,确认“Request timeout”不为0(防止无限挂起),并根据开发环境决定是否开启“SSL certificate verification”。如果你正在调试内部自签名证书的HTTPS接口,务必将此项关闭,否则会频繁触发“SSL Error: Self signed certificate”报错,导致请求无法发出。

Postman相关配图

实战场景一:攻克HTTPS接口调试中的SSL校验难题

在真实的开发场景中,许多企业内部测试环境使用自签名证书。新手在使用Postman访问这些接口时,常会遇到“Could not get any response”的提示。此时,不要盲目检查网络,应查看底部的Console控制台。如果显示“SSL Error”,请点击右侧的小齿轮图标进入设置,在General面板中找到“SSL certificate verification”开关并将其置为OFF。此外,针对需要双向认证的场景,Postman支持在“Certificates”选项卡中手动添加PFX或CRT证书。通过这种精细化配置,你可以模拟复杂的生产安全环境,确保在正式上线前扫清所有握手协议层面的障碍。

Postman相关配图

效率进阶:利用环境变量实现多套环境无缝切换

拒绝硬编码是Postman使用教程的核心逻辑。在实际项目中,我们通常拥有Local、Dev、Staging和Prod四套环境。通过点击右上角的“Environment Quick Look”,你可以创建不同的环境模板。例如,定义一个名为`base_url`的变量。在请求URL中,使用双花括号语法`{{base_url}}/api/v1/login`来引用。当需要从本地联调切换到测试服时,只需在右上角的下拉菜单中一键切换,无需手动修改每一个接口地址。此外,利用“Pre-request Script”可以实现动态参数注入,例如使用`pm.environment.set("timestamp", Date.now());`来为每个请求自动生成时间戳,规避接口幂等性校验带来的重复提交问题。

Postman相关配图

数据安全:从Scratchpad到Workspace的迁移策略

随着Postman产品策略的调整,旧版的离线模式(Scratchpad)已逐步退出舞台,这让许多习惯本地存储的用户感到困惑。在当前版本中,建议新手通过“Import”功能将旧有的JSON Collection导入到私有Workspace中。如果公司对数据合规性有严格要求,可以利用Postman的“Export”功能定期将集合导出为v2.1格式的JSON文件进行本地备份。在进行版本更新或更换办公设备时,只需登录账号,所有的环境变量、全局设置和接口文档都会自动同步。这种云端同步机制不仅解决了数据丢失风险,更通过“Collections Share”功能极大地降低了前后端联调时的沟通成本。

常见问题

为什么我的Postman更新后找不到之前的本地测试记录了?

这是因为新版本强制推行Workspace协作模式。请检查左上角的“Scratchpad”是否已迁移,或点击“Settings”->“Data”进行手动导入。建议登录账号以确保数据自动同步到云端空间。

接口返回的JSON数据乱码或无法折叠显示怎么办?

这通常是由于Header中的Content-Type识别错误。请在请求头的“Accept”字段手动指定为“application/json”。若依然乱码,请检查控制台编码设置,确保Response Body的预览模式选为“Pretty”而非“Raw”。

如何在内网无公网环境下正常使用Postman?

Postman支持离线运行,但无法使用云端同步功能。你可以在有网环境下下载安装包,安装后跳过登录步骤。对于内网API,需确保Postman Desktop Agent已正确安装,并在设置中关闭代理(Proxy)自动检测,防止请求被重定向到错误的网关。

总结

立即前往官方下载页面获取最新版 Postman,开启高效 API 开发与自动化测试之旅。

相关阅读:Postman使用教程使用技巧Postman汉化教程:2024最新汉化补丁安装及app.asar替换实操指南

Postman使用教程 Postman